48
MAMA CAN'T BUY YOU LOVE
Year: 1979
Album: The Thom Bell Sessions [E.P.]
"Mama Can't Buy You Love" become Elton's 3rd entry on the R&B Chart. The song topped the US AC Chart as well as going Top 10 Pop. The soul track was written by Thom Bell with musician Casey James. The latter had previously worked with the former's nephew Leroy. Thom brought the R&B duo to Kenny Gamble & Leon Huff's Philadelphia International Records. Elton recorded the E.P. with many Phillie Soul alumni, including The Spinners and M.F.S.B.

41
CAN YOU FEEL THE
LOVE TONIGHT
Year: 1994
Album: The Lion King (film soundtrack)
Elton composed the music for "Can You Feel The Love Tonight" with lyricist Tim Rice. It was the major hit song from the animated Disney film 'The Lion King'. The ballad collected a Grammy, Golden Globe and Academy Award.
